The Hidden Danger of Standard Steel Tools

In flammable and explosive atmospheres, regular steel tools can produce frictional sparks upon impact. In a zone surrounded by hydrocarbon vapors, natural gas, or volatile chemicals, even a single spark can trigger a catastrophic explosion. This is why safety-conscious organizations in oil & gas, petrochemical, and chemical industries are mandated to use non-sparking tools as per OISD (Oil Industry Safety Directorate) guidelines and international safety standards.

What Are Non-Sparking Tools?

Non-sparking tools are made from non-ferrous copper alloys such as Aluminium Bronze (AlBr) and Beryllium Copper (BeCu). These spark-resistant materials do not generate ignition sparks when struck against hard surfaces, making them ideal for use in hazardous environments. Where Are These Tools Used?

Non-sparking safety tools are widely used across oil refineries, gas pipelines, petrochemical plants, LNG terminals, mining operations, breweries, distilleries, and chemical processing units. Leading organizations like IOCL, BPCL, HPCL, GAIL, and Reliance Industries rely on these tools for day-to-day maintenance and emergency operations. The OISD emergency tool kit is a standard requirement at most oil & gas sites across India.
